Gap Personnel who are operating as an employment business are currently recruiting on behalf of our client for a Hygiene Operative for a company based in Knowsley area.The position is a permanent contract for suitable candidates.Job descriptionPositionHygiene OperativeHours of Work10pm - 7amClosing Date for Applications08/08/2022Job RoleWorking as part of the hygiene team to ensure excellent standards are maintained as well as supporting the smooth running of Production.Reporting toHygiene SupervisorMain Duties & Responsibilities

  • To remove the waste of any product left over from production
  • To clean equipment and facilities to the standards as set out by site and customer standards
  • Follow Standard Operating Procedures for completion of hygiene tasks
  • Clean down of machinery and production areas as per Standard Operating Procedures
  • Ensure all chemicals are used as specified and within procedures outlined
  • Ensure that floors are swept and cleared down as appropriate
  • Completion of line wash downs in a timely and consistent manner including changeovers
  • Build-up of machinery after hygiene work has been completed
  • Raise any training issues with HR or the Training Manager
  • Maintain a clean as you go area and demonstrate good manufacturing practice (GMP)
  • Support the need for change and actively get involved in continually looking for ways to improve performance
  • Takes part in Continuous Improvement activities and contribute suggestions to improve line performance
  • Help during changes on the line learning new skills as required
  • Work on different lines and areas where required
  • Comply with all company procedures and codes of practice to ensure a safe and hygienic workplace
  • Complete regular/routine tasks without being asked
  • Focus on attention to detail and maintaining high standards.
  • Other duties relating to this role and Production Environment
Knowledge & Experience
  • At least 2-3 years experience in a fast-paced food manufacturing environment.
  • Previous experience working with high pressure water and / or chemicals will be advantageous.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to take direction.
  • Ability to challenge others in a professional and constructive manner.
  • Knowledge of chemicals and machinery which is used in the clean down process.
  • Understanding of Environmental requirements and responsibilities.
